JEFFERSON CITY – The Missouri Baptist Convention’s (MBC) Christian Life Commission (CLC) has created resources to help churches defend life by speaking out against Amendment 3 – a proposed amendment to the Missouri Constitution that would codify extensive abortion rights. The CLC is the public policy arm of the MBC. ‘Ties That Bind’: Ministry Wives Luncheon scheduled for Oct. 29
ST. CHARLES – The Missouri Baptist Convention’s 2024 Ministry Wives Luncheon is scheduled for Tuesday, Oct. 29, at 11:30am in the St. Charles Convention Center here. The luncheon’s theme is “Table Talk: Ties That Bind.” A Ministry Wives Network panel will walk with luncheon guests through the theme passage, Colossians 3:12-17. MBC’s Christian Life Commission hosting pastors’ dinner, Oct. 27
ST. CHARLES – The Missouri Baptist Convention’s (MBC) Christian Life Commission is hosting a pastors’ dinner, Oct. 27, before the MBC annual meeting in St. Charles. The dinner for MBC ministers and their wives will be followed by presentations from MBC President Chris Williams, pastor of Fellowship Church, Greenwood/Raymore, and Bev Ehlen, state director of Concerned Women for America of Missouri. Missouri DR workers to provide childcare at annual meeting
ST. CHARLES – Trained volunteers from Missouri Baptist Disaster Relief (DR) will provide childcare on Monday and Tuesday of the Missouri Baptist Convention annual meeting here, Oct. 28-29. Registration is free, but required. The deadline for registration is Oct. 13. Childcare is being offered for children from birth through 7 years of age. MBF board of trustees meets, Aug. 16
JEFFERSON CITY (BHHM) – The Missouri Baptist Foundation (MBF) met for its Aug. 16 board meeting at the Baptist Building in Jefferson City. The 12-member board, elected by the messengers at the MBC annual meeting, approved the 2024-25 budget, appointed a task force to review its policy and procedures manual, and set its annual dividend rate for its long-term funds. ‘Consider Christ’: Missouri Baptist Pastors’ Conference set for Monday, Oct. 28
ST. CHARLES – The Missouri Baptist Pastors’ Conference is set to take place at the St. Charles Convention Center here, Oct. 28. The conference, which precedes the Missouri Baptist Convention’s (MBC) annual meeting, begins at 8:30 a.m. and ends at 2:20 p.m. The theme of the MBC Pastors’ Conference is “Consider Christ,” based on Hebrews 3:1-2.
